The A3P1000-FGG484 is an advanced IC (integrated circuit) component from Microsemi Corporation. As a field-programmable gate array (FPGA), it offers a wide range of features and capabilities for designing and implementing complex digital logic circuits. Here's an overview of its key features:
1. Programmability: The A3P1000-FGG484 is highly configurable, allowing designers to program the functionality of the device according to their specific requirements. This FPGA's programmability enables rapid prototyping and iterative design changes without the need for manufacturing new hardware.
2. Logic Capacity: This IC component offers a logic capacity of approximately 1 million system gates, making it suitable for medium to large-scale digital designs. The abundant logic resources enable designers to implement intricate functionalities and complex algorithms within a single device.
3. High-Speed Performance: The FPGA supports high-speed operation, with clock frequencies reaching up to several hundred megahertz. This performance makes it ideal for applications that demand speedy data processing and real-time response, such as signal processing, communications, and high-performance computing.
4. Ample On-Chip Memory: The A3P1000-FGG484 incorporates generous on-chip memory resources comprising built-in RAM blocks and embedded multipliers. These resources enable efficient implementation of data storage, buffering, and complex mathematical operations within the FPGA itself, reducing the need for external memory components and enhancing overall system performance
